API Setup and Explanation

Enabled: Indicates whether the Hospital Communication Worklist API has been turned on.  If you plan to send your hospital communications manually via a third party email system, you can leave this disabled.

Auto Start:  This indicates that after the API server reboots, either on schedule or after an unexpected shutdown, the API should automatically come back on as well.  This should be turned on unless you are troubleshooting problems with the API, to ensure there is no lapse in the flow of communication.

Update Status Check Job:  This is the frequency which the API will check for and process new pending messages.  60 seconds is the default, but you can modify this to adjust performance as necessary (slower servers may want to have a longer check time to allow for processing, e.g. 300 seconds to only check and process messages once every 5 minutes.)  

Communication Error:  This will display any error states that returned the last time the API attempted to process messages.  This is useful information for troubleshooting any issues.

Messages to Print:  The "email to address"  will CC a copy of all print communications to the selected email addresses.

Error Notification:  The "email to address" will send a copy of the error notification to the selected email addresses.  If you have an automated ticket generation system set up, this can be used to trigger automatic escalation based on your ticketing system's parameters.

Enable Test Mode:  If you are working in a sandbox or are verifying the appearance of the automated emails, turn this on to route all emails to the selected email address instead of using the client's real email address.  Stop the interface and turn this off once you are ready to go live with the API on your production system.

Save allows you to save any changes you have made to the API prior to starting the interference.

Start Interface turns on the Hospital Communications Worklist API with the settings you have chosen.  If you want to make and save any changes, you must Stop Interface before applying the changes.
